用NAS也能打造你的專屬雲端檔案同步伺服器—CloudStation

6
37,219 人次

image

隨著光纖網路的普及,以及網路頻寬的加大,越來越多使用者開始使用雲端檔案儲存服務,逐漸捨棄USB隨身碟。有沒有辦法在辦公室或家中架設屬於自己的雲端主機呢?答案是可以的,現在的NAS(網路儲存設備)已經開始提供了類似Dropbox的同步軟體,可以讓你輕鬆打造「私有雲」,不但空間更大而且同步更快,本篇就是阿正老師使用Synology NAS加上「Cloud Station」打造專屬私有雲的介紹,如果你常用雲端服務,卻嫌空間不夠的話,不妨參考看看吧!

 

為什麼要打造「私有雲」?

美國的Dropbox、Box.com、Sugarsync…都是熱門的雲端儲存服務,尤其是Dropbox以方便易用的介面,吸引了非常多使用者來使用該公司的雲端服務,但是畢竟這些服務所提供的空間有限(例如Dropbox一開始只有2GB),而且因伺服器主機放在國外導致同步速度較慢,甚至Dropbox在去年還發生過不用密碼就能登入帳號的bug,讓不少使用者對這種「公有雲」感到擔心。

下圖是目前公有雲的架構,不論你是在辦公室或家中,都必須將資料透過Internet傳送到雲端儲存主機,因為目前主流的雲端服務多在美國,當你使用的網路業者(ISP)對國外的頻寬不足,或是遇到尖峰時段對國外網路塞車時,要同步檔案就必須花費相當長的時間,相當不便。

image

因此除了擁抱公有雲,最好也能有屬於自己的「私有雲」,像阿正老師家中使用的Synology(群暉)所推出的網路儲存設備(NAS),就提供了類似Dropbox的同步軟體,只要將NAS架在辦公室或家中,只要是跟NAS屬於同一個區域網路的電腦都可透過高速的網路來存取NAS裡面的檔案,當你人在外面或家中時,也可透過同步軟體直接存取NAS的檔案,因為NAS是放在國內,連線速度也相當快,不必忍受連到國外網路塞車的窘境。

image

 

Synology DSM 4.0

Synology是國內知名的NAS製造商,該公司在今年將NAS的作業系統升級到DSM 4.0,除了有更人性化、更直覺的操作介面外,利用瀏覽器就可直接對NAS進行管理及多工作業,等於是你的雲端作業系統。

在DSM 4.0版有個很重要的雲端檔案同步功能,叫做「Cloud Station」,只要開啟該功能,並在遠端的電腦安裝Cloud Station應用程式,就可透過網路來進行檔案的同步。

SNAGHTML21d143

即使你的NAS放在有防火牆保護的區域網路中,無法設定對外的連接埠對應(port mapping),依然可以透過該公司的ezCloud服務,建立一個網路加密通道,即使你不知道NAS的IP,一樣可以照樣連線、穿透防火牆,操作相當簡單。

SNAGHTML21a69b

啟動Cloud Station

只要從NAS的管理後台,點選「套件中心」,按下「Cloud Station」下面的〔啟動〕按鈕,就可開啟Cloud Station這項功能。

image

啟動後可以從後台左上角的功能選單中,找到Cloud Station的圖示,按一下該圖示及可進入Cloud Station的設定。

image

進入Cloud Station畫面後,先將上方的「啟動Cloud Station」打勾,然後按下〔套用〕按鈕,即可啟動該服務。

image

接著點選左邊的「權限」,可看到目前NAS裡面的使用者,可針對部份使用者開放Cloud Station功能,只要將使用者名稱右邊的核取方塊打勾,按下〔儲存〕,該使用者即可享受Cloud Station的服務。

那麼他的空間有多大呢?Cloud Station所使用的空間其實就是該使用者的家目錄下的「Cloud Station」資料夾,所以是合併在整個使用者空間配額裡面一起計算的。如此一來使用者有了Cloud Station之後,就不用再怕Dropbox的空間不夠用啦!

image

設定連線方式

Synology的Cloud Station有兩種連線同步方式,一種是透過ezCloud伺服器連線,另一種是直接輸入IP位址來連線。

透過ezCloud來連線的好處是,你不需要去修改防火牆或IP分享器的設定,就可以直接穿透防火牆(類似TeamViewer或Skype),外部的只要輸入ezCloud識別碼即可連線到NAS,但缺點是ezCloud伺服器有頻寬的限制,同步的速度較慢。

如果是外面的電腦直接透過IP位址的方式來連線,則你必須先設定好動態DNS(DDNS),或是申請一組固定IP,並在你的IP分享器或防火牆上,將區域網路內NAS的6690埠對應到外部真實IP,如此一來才能由外面的電腦連線。這種連線方式雖然較複雜,但是因為不會經過ezCloud伺服器,因此NAS的網路上傳頻寬有多大,外部的電腦連線速度就有多快,可完全利用到網路的頻寬。

image

下面分別介紹兩種連線的設定方式:

1.ezCloud

從DSM 4.0介面的「控制台」→「ezCloud」進入,將上方「QuickConnect」的「Cloud Station」選項打勾,下方的ezCloud資訊中會出現一組「ezCloud識別碼」,你可以讓外部的電腦透過這組識別碼,經由ezCloud伺服器的網路轉送通道連到這台NAS來存取資料。

如果你不想用ezCloud配發的識別碼,也可按下〔自訂〕按鈕,自行輸入你想取的識別碼名稱(英文字或數字均可),設定完成後看到ezCloud下方的「狀態」出現「已連線」,表示已經成功讓NAS連線到ezCloud伺服器了。

image

2.透過IP位址連線

如果你會設定防火牆或IP分享器,只要找到「Port Forwarding」、「Port Mapping」、「連接埠對應」或「虛擬伺服器」的選項(不同設備所使用的名稱都不太一樣),將NAS的6690埠對應到外部,就可以讓Cloud Station服務經由NAT的方式穿透到外部了。

如下圖就是中華電信的光世代所使用的ZyXEL數據機,在裡面找到「Port Forwarding」,設定服務的名稱、開始埠/結束埠及伺服器IP位址(NAS的IP),按鈕〔儲存〕按鈕即可完成設定。

image

>>請翻到下一頁:電腦端使用方式、分享Cloud Station裡面的檔案

6 意見

  1. 當然也可以,只是不像cloudstation那麼方便而已。
    一般都會用同步軟體,透過像是webDAV、ftp、 Rsync…等方式來進行同步,或是可以用VPN連進跟NAS同一個網段直接用網芳來存取檔案。
    cloudstation好處是模仿dropbox,可以用方便的軟體進行一對多的同步,無須再去煩惱設定或如何同步的問題。

發表迴響